What to tell me about minimally invasive coronary bypass surgery?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Creighton Wright answered

Specializes in surgery

Possible: There are some indications, and some risks. Many patients have multiple vessels involved and on the back of the heart. Standard operation gives great exposure, full revasculariazion with low risk through the years. Some minimal are also not so minimal!, when examined!
